Getting There and Around

Arrival

Airports: The nearest airport to Valera is Dr. Antonio Nicolás Briceño Airport (VLV), which offers domestic flights within Venezuela.

Train Stations: Valera does not have a train station.

Bus Terminals: The city has a central bus terminal with connections to various destinations within the country.

Transportation

Public Transport Options: Valera has a network of public buses and taxis that provide convenient transportation within the city.

Car Rentals: Car rental services are available for visitors who prefer to explore the region at their own pace.

Bike Shares: Bike-sharing facilities are not widely available in Valera.

Tips: It is advisable to arrange transportation in advance, especially for exploring attractions outside the city center.
